Low Income Housing Designed to Meet Need

Housing is one of the most basic of human needs. The term includes a broad spectrum of abodes, from mansions down to minimal shelter. In this country, at this time, everyone should be able to afford a decent place to live. Like most places, adequate good housing is at a premium in this area. Those at the lower end of the economy feel that shortage even more keenly than others.
